The aftermath of the Brexit vote ? the verdict from a derided expert
John Van Reenen was disappointed but not surprised by the UK?s vote to Leave the EU. Whilst his own research predicts serious economic and political damage in the case of Brexit, he thought a Leave vote was a real possibility ever since David Cameron committed to a vote in 2013.
